728x90
반응형
728x170
■ FormatConvertedBitmap 클래스를 사용해 비트맵 소스의 픽셀 포맷을 변경하는 방법을 보여준다.
▶ 예제 코드 (C#)
#region FormatConvertedBitmap 객체 구하기 - GetFormatConvertedBitmap(bitmapSource, targetPixelFormat)
/// <summary>
/// FormatConvertedBitmap 객체 구하기
/// </summary>
/// <param name="bitmapSource">비트맵 소스</param>
/// <param name="targetPixelFormat">타겟 픽셀 포맷</param>
/// <returns>FormatConvertedBitmap 객체</returns>
public FormatConvertedBitmap GetFormatConvertedBitmap(BitmapSource bitmapSource, PixelFormat targetPixelFormat)
{
FormatConvertedBitmap formatConvertedBitmap = new FormatConvertedBitmap();
formatConvertedBitmap.BeginInit();
formatConvertedBitmap.Source = bitmapSource;
formatConvertedBitmap.DestinationFormat = targetPixelFormat;
formatConvertedBitmap.EndInit();
return formatConvertedBitmap;
}
#endregion
728x90
반응형
그리드형(광고전용)
'C# > WPF' 카테고리의 다른 글
[C#/WPF] Canvas 엘리먼트 : Thumb 엘리먼트를 이용해 캔버스 크기 조정하기 (0) | 2014.01.31 |
---|---|
[C#/WPF] BulletDecorator 엘리먼트 사용하기 (0) | 2014.01.31 |
[C#/WPF] Label 엘리먼트 : Target 속성 사용하기 (0) | 2014.01.31 |
[C#/WPF] CroppedBitmap 클래스 : 비트맵 소스에서 비트맵 잘라내기 (0) | 2014.01.31 |
[C#/WPF] CroppedBitmap 엘리먼트 : SourceRect 속성 사용하기 (0) | 2014.01.31 |
[C#/WPF] FormatConvertedBitmap 엘리먼트 : DestinationFormat 속성을 사용해 비트맵 픽셀 포맷 변경하기 (0) | 2014.01.31 |
[C#/WPF] BitmapImage 클래스 : 크기 조정 비트맵 이미지 구하기 (0) | 2014.01.31 |
[C#/WPF] BitmapImage 엘리먼트 : DecodePixelWidth/DecodePixelHeight 속성 사용하기 (0) | 2014.01.31 |
[C#/WPF] Image 엘리먼트 : Width 속성 사용하기 (0) | 2014.01.31 |
[C#/WPF] Storyboard 클래스 : 코드 구현하기 (0) | 2014.01.31 |
댓글을 달아 주세요